Pivot suhu menurut kota dan tahun
Menarik untuk melihat bagaimana suhu di setiap kota berubah dari waktu ke waktu—melihat tiap bulan menghasilkan tabel besar yang bisa sulit dianalisis. Sebagai gantinya, mari lihat bagaimana suhu berubah per tahun.
Anda dapat mengakses komponen tanggal (tahun, bulan, dan hari) menggunakan kode dengan bentuk dataframe["column"].dt.component. Misalnya, komponen bulan adalah dataframe["column"].dt.month, dan komponen tahun adalah dataframe["column"].dt.year.
Setelah Anda memiliki kolom tahun, Anda dapat membuat tabel pivot dengan data dikelompokkan berdasarkan kota dan tahun, yang akan Anda eksplorasi pada latihan berikutnya.
pandas telah dimuat sebagai pd. tersediatemperatures.
Latihan ini adalah bagian dari kursus
Manipulasi Data dengan pandas
Petunjuk latihan
- Tambahkan kolom
yearketemperatures, dari komponenyearpada kolomdate. - Buat tabel pivot dari kolom
avg_temp_c, dengancountrydancitysebagai baris, danyearsebagai kolom. Simpan sebagaitemp_by_country_city_vs_year, lalu lihat hasilnya.
Latihan interaktif praktis
Cobalah latihan ini dengan menyelesaikan kode contoh berikut.
# Add a year column to temperatures
____
# Pivot avg_temp_c by country and city vs year
temp_by_country_city_vs_year = ____
# See the result
print(temp_by_country_city_vs_year)